(i) The National Stock Exchange was rated as one of the leading exchanges in India and the second largest in the world with respect to trade in equity shares between January and June 2018, according to the report published by the World Federation of Exchanges (WFE).
(ii) NSE pioneered electronic screen-based trading in 1994, derivatives trading (in the form of index futures) in 2000, and internet trading, all of which were the first in India.
(iii) NSE has a full-fledged business model comprising the listing of our exchanges, trading services, clearing and settlement, indices, and market data feeds with technology solutions and financial education. NSE also oversees compliance on the part of trading and clearing members and listed companies with rules and regulations for its exchange.
(iv) NSE is a pioneer of technological innovations and has assured reliability on the performance of its systems by instilling a culture of innovation and investment in technology. NSE is able to react fast to the demands and changes in the market in providing a superior service in trading and non-trading activities, providing them with good quality data and services.
(v) NSE was incorporated in 1992, recognized by SEBI as a stock exchange in April 1993, and commenced operations in 1994 with the launch of the wholesale debt market, followed closely by the launch of the cash market segment..
History of NSE
1995-Set up wholly-owned subsidiary NSE Clearing, which by virtue of the Oliver Wyman Report had become the first clearing corporation to be established in India. Clearing and settlement operations, as commenced in the following year.
1998- Set up NSE Indices, a subsidiary joint venture with CRISIL Limited to operate an indices business. NSE Indices became a wholly-owned subsidiary in 2013 after acquiring CRISIL’s 49% stake.
1999-NSEIT, a wholly-owned global technology firm providing end-to-end technology solutions, was set up. Such services include application services, infrastructure services, analytics as a service, and IT-enabled services. NSEIT launched its Testing Centre of Excellence in 2015 and its Integrated Security Response Center in 2016.
2000-To incorporate DotEx, a wholly-owned subsidiary, that U.S.-based data and info-vending business on behalf of DotEx.
2006- Set up NSE Infotech Ltd., a wholly-owned subsidiary for IT research and development.
2016-Consolidated education business under NSE Academy-Incorporation of two new subsidiaries, NSE IFSC Limited and NSE IFSC Clearing Corporation Limited, in pursuance of NSE’s long-term business strategy to establish an international exchange in GIFT City.
